The Importance of Privacy in Online Casinos

Privacy is a major concern in online casinos as players provide a wealth of personal data, from contact details to financial information. The potential misuse of this data could lead to severe consequences, including identity theft and financial loss. Privacy isn't just about keeping personal information safe; it's also about ensuring that all transactions remain confidential and that players' activities are not exposed or exploited undesirably.

Regulations and Licenses

The credibility of an online casino can often be assessed by its licensing status. Casinos licensed under stringent regulators such as the UK Gambling Commission, Malta Gaming Authority, or Gibraltar Regulatory Authority must comply with rigorous data protection standards and are regularly audited for compliance. These licenses are not just pieces of paper but are assurances of the casino's commitment to protecting player data.

Risks Associated with Online Gambling

Despite robust security protocols, risks remain. Players may encounter phishing scams aimed at extracting personal information. Additionally, playing at unlicensed casinos can be particularly dangerous as these platforms do not adhere to any regulatory standards, leaving personal data at risk of misuse.

Tips for Protecting Your Privacy and Security

To mitigate risks and enhance your online gambling experience, consider the following tips:

  1. Choose a Licensed Casino: Verify the casino's licensing information before signing up.
  2. Use Strong Passwords: Employ complex passwords and update them periodically.
  3. Enable Two-Factor Authentication: This adds an extra layer of security by requiring not only a password and username but also something that only the user has on them.
  4. Monitor Your Accounts: Keep an eye on your banking and casino accounts for any suspicious activity.
  5. Be Wary of Phishing: Exercise caution with emails or messages that solicit personal information.
  6. Use Secure Connections: Always use a secure and private internet connection when playing online, especially when making transactions.
